Not in November, but in Iraq. Lindsey Graham’s speech has been about the most war- and surge-centric speech I’ve heard yet. He also gives credit to Joe Lieberman, and the delegates applaud enthusiastically. Graham accuses Obama of offering the troops “a patronizing pat on the back.”
UPDATE: Graham just said, echoing the Democratic nominee, “I’m not saying Barack Obama doesn’t care. I’m just saying he doesn’t get it.”
